Slide 6: Technology Solutions
- Warehouse Management Systems: WMS enhances inventory control by automating stock tracking, reducing errors by 30%, and improving order fulfillment speed by 25% in modern warehouses.
- Transportation Management Systems: TMS optimizes route planning, leading to a 15% reduction in transportation costs and a 20% improvement in delivery times through advanced algorithms.
- Supply Chain Visibility Tools: Real-time tracking tools provide 95% visibility across the supply chain, enabling proactive decision-making and reducing delays by up to 40%.
- Data Analytics Platforms: Analytics platforms deliver actionable insights, improving operational efficiency by 20% and enabling data-driven decisions that enhance overall supply chain performance.

Common Questions About Supply Chain Optimization
What are the main benefits of supply chain optimization?
Supply chain optimization leads to reduced costs, improved efficiency, and enhanced customer satisfaction. By streamlining processes and leveraging technology, organizations can respond more swiftly to market demands and minimize delays.

What technology solutions are effective for supply chain optimization?
Effective technology solutions for supply chain optimization include Warehouse Management Systems (WMS) and Transportation Management Systems (TMS). These tools help automate processes, improve inventory control, and optimize route planning.
What challenges might I face when optimizing a supply chain?
Common challenges include increased lead times, rising transportation costs, and supply chain disruptions. Identifying these issues early and implementing targeted solutions is essential for successful optimization.
